Suffers Grade 2 hamstring strain
Peguero was diagnosed with a Grade 2 hamstring strain Wednesday, Alex Pavlovic of NBC Sports Bay Area reports.
Impact
Peguero is expected to be sidelined for multiple weeks. He initially suffered the hamstring injury 16 days ago but apparently aggravated it in recent days and will now face an even longer recovery period. Peguero was competing for a prominent role in the Giants' bullpen after pitching in 17 games for San Francisco last season. He registered a 2.42 ERA, 1.03 WHIP and 17:8 K:BB across his first 22.1 big-league innings.

On track to play this week
Peguero (hamstring) threw a live batting practice session Friday and is on track to play this week, Maria Guardado of MLB.com reports.
Impact
Peguero began experiencing tightness in his left hamstring in mid-February but is progressing toward his Cactus League debut. The right-hander made 17 relief appearances for the Giants in 2025 after his contract was selected from Triple-A Sacramento in August, recording a 2.42 ERA, 1.03 WHIP and 17:8 K:BB across 22.1 innings.

Slated to face hitters Friday
Peguero (hamstring) will throw another bullpen session Tuesday before advancing to a live batting practice session Friday, Justice delos Santos of The San Jose Mercury News reports...
Impact
Peguero's recovery from left hamstring tightness is coming along well. As long as he gets through his next two throwing sessions with no issues, he'll likely be cleared to pitch in Cactus League games. Peguero could be used in a setup role this season for the Giants.

In mix for relief spot
Peguero is a candidate to join the Giants' bullpen during the 2025 campaign, Maria Guardado of MLB.com reports.
Impact
Peguero, a non-roster invitee to spring training, has made eight appearances in Cactus League play, allowing zero runs, with one walk and eight strikeouts across 6.2 innings. The right-handed pitcher's high-octane stuff has been on display thus far, and he has topped out at 102 MPH this spring. The 27-year-old has yet to make his major-league debut, though his impressive velocity has made him a candidate for a call-up. "We're certainly not ruling him out," manager Bob Melvin said. "It's a credit to him for not only opening some eyes but continuing to do it." Peguero registered a 3.14 ERA and 56:17 K:BB over 51.2 innings with the Tigers' Double-A affiliate in Erie last season, and he will likely start the 2025 campaign with the Giants' Triple-A affiliate in Sacramento.

Inks NRI deal with San Francisco
The Giants signed Peguero to a minor-league contract Friday that includes an invitation to spring training, Shayna Rubin of the San Francisco Chronicle reports.
Impact
Peguero, 27, held a 3.14 ERA and 56:17 K:BB over 51.2 frames with Double-A Erie in the Tigers organization in 2024. He has yet to make his major-league debut and is likely to open 2025 in the Triple-A Sacramento bullpen.
